Abstract: Lithium-ion (Li-ion) batteries have become indispensable in powering a wide range of technologies, from consumer electronics to electric vehicles (EVs) and renewable energy storage systems. Li-ion batteries' market share and specific applications have grown significantly over time and are still rising. What are the future prospects for solar energy?
Future prospects highlight promising trends such as next-generation photovoltaics, advanced energy storage solutions, agrivoltaics, floating solar farms, and artificial photosynthesis.
How has research & development impacted solar PV technology?
In recent years, massive research and development (R&D) efforts have been directed towards advancing solar PV technologies. These efforts have led to significant advancements in solar cell technologies, focusing on improving efficiency and reducing costs.
